NCAA Addresses Wearable Technology in Latest Swim/Dive Rulebook Update
The NCAA will not allow swimmers to wear any technology that transmits information to an athlete in real-time, only devices for “data collection.”
Niagara Swimmers Sue School Over Alleged Harassment By Men’s Swimmers
Three members of the Niagara women’s swim team say members of the men’s team harassed them, and the coach of both programs didn’t properly address complaints.

Buffalo City Swim Racers Receive $290,000 Grant to Expand Programming
The Buffalo City Swim Racers, a nonprofit that provides free or low-cost swimming lessons to families, has secured a grant to expand its programming.
